Transaction 38b34912bc2894bbf58488326fec44029932d9b26c9f952ad612a938685218cb

1 Input
2 Outputs
  • 38b34912bc2894bbf58488326fec44029932d9b26c9f952ad612a938685218cb:0
  • value  128697344
    address  19XhhrL2WTf7D53qK91bdRYP4LAysAc6XS
  • 38b34912bc2894bbf58488326fec44029932d9b26c9f952ad612a938685218cb:1
  • value  554289
    address  3LMVCaLP1arJeXLSYF2iZqshDZK7zM9XH8